    Microsoft and Inworld AI Join Forces to Create Generative AI Tools for Xbox Game Development

    Microsoft has announced a multi-year partnership with Inworld AI to develop generative AI tools for Xbox game developers. The collaboration aims to empower creators with AI-driven tools for building characters, stories, quests, and dialogue, leveraging large language models similar to those powering OpenAI’s GPT.

    The partnership will produce an “AI design copilot” system that helps developers create detailed scripts, dialogue trees, and quest lines. Additionally, an AI character engine will enable more immersive and dynamic in-game interactions. The tools are designed to be cross-platform and accessible to developers of all sizes, from indie studios to major AAA teams.

    Ilya Gelfenbeyn, CEO of Inworld AI, noted that generative AI unlocks new opportunities for storytelling and character engagement within games. Haiyan Zhang, General Manager of Gaming AI at Xbox, emphasized that the approach is rooted in meaningful innovation, empowering people, and responsibility. She stated that the tools will be built on Microsoft’s AI principles and Responsible AI Standard.

    This announcement follows Microsoft’s broader AI push, including the recent introduction of Copilot for Office, which automates tasks like email drafting and document summarization. By extending generative AI into gaming, Microsoft aims to reduce complexity for developers and enhance player experiences, particularly as the metaverse and VR/AR sectors are projected to grow to $615 billion by 2030.

    The partnership brings together Inworld’s expertise in generative AI for characters, Microsoft’s Azure OpenAI Service, Microsoft Research’s insights into future play, and Xbox’s legacy of responsible creator tools. Together, they plan to deliver an accessible, responsibly designed multi-platform toolset for dialogue, story, and quest design.
